Ch.1. Introduction • Environmental Geochemistry? • The application of chemical principles to predictethe fate of organic and inorganic pollutants at the earth's surface and in the atmosphere (R.Stoessel) • Applying geochemical knowledge to solve environmental problems
Ch.1. • Some Concepts for EG • Earth is a closed but dynamic system It stays in the system but cycles through the system (e.g. rock cycle, water cycle, sulfur cycle, etc.) • Earth is practically the only home for human beings within our reach in the Universe • Need to balance development with conservation Sustainability!! • Environmental impact may seem little before getting the critical point • A lot slower recovery than pollution, which is of course extremely expensive Problems for generation after generation • Recovery (restoration, remediation) is never perfect. • Environmental Science is a comprehensive study field
